NOTICE ID: M68909-26-I-7715 The Marine Corps Tactical Systems Support Activity (MCTSSA) is publicizing this SOURCES SOUGHT NOTICE as a means of conducting tactical market research. THIS IS NOT A REQUEST FOR QUOTATION (RFQ) OR INVITATION FOR BID (IFB) and shall not be construed as a commitment by the Government to issue a solicitation or ultimately award a contract. This is a Request for Information (RFI). Responses will not be considered as quotations, nor will any award be made as a result. The Marine Corps will not be responsible for any costs incurred by interested parties in responding to this notice. This Sources Sought is issued under NAICS code 334111; PSC 7B22 to determine potential authorized resellers capable of delivering the item identified below by the identified Need by Date. Note: NAICS and PSC codes are notional. Resellers are encouraged to suggest NAICS and PSC codes that are a better fit for the requirement. SCOPE OF WORK: Item is “Brand Name or Equal.” MCTSSA is inquiring if authorized resellers are capable of providing the item listed below by the Need by Date: 29 September 2026 Item Manufacturer Part Number Item Description QTY Description 1 Sealing Tech Server and Networking Equipment (Hardware) (SBA) MCTSSA KIT 1 x SN7100 with a 64-core AMD EPYC CPU, 576GB DDR5 RAM, TPM 2.0, 1 x 1TBM.2 NVME, 8 x 7.68TB U.2 NVME SSDs, an LSI Raid Card, a 4-Port SFP28 NIC, and a 1-year KYD Warranty. It also includes 2 x SN3100 servers, each with a 20-core CPU, 128GB DDR4 RAM, 1 x 1TB M.2 NVME, 1 x 15.36TB U.2 NVME SSD, and a 1-year KYD Warranty. The SealingTech 3U Case 2 includes 2 x 1U Drawers and 1 x QNAP US 30-Port Management Switch with 2 x 100Gbe, 2 x 25Gbe, and 24 x 10Gbe RJ45 ports. 1 EA Hardware stack that supports the collection and analysis of network traffic. Equipment will be used to research strategies for defending USMC programs of record in the developmental phase. -- 1 of 2 -- The information provided in the Sources Sought is subject to change and is not binding by the Government.
